Cocaine (album)

Cocaine
Studio album by Z-Ro
Released October 27, 2009
Genre Hip hop, gangsta rap
Label Rap-a-Lot Records
Producer Z-Ro, Bigg Tyme, Big E, Beans N Kornbread

Cocaine is the thirteenth solo album by Z-Ro. Guests include Lil' O, Mike D, Big Pokey, Lil' Flip, Billy Cook, Gucci Mane, and Chris Ward.

Sample credits

  • "Intro" – Contains a sample of "Happiness" by Maze featuring Frankie Beverly
  • "That's the Type of N**** I Am" – Contains a sample of "Sweet Dreams" by Air Supply
  • "I Don't Give a Damn" – Contains a sample of "Street Life" by The Crusaders
  • "Can't Leave Drank Alone" – Contains a sample of "Feenin'" by Jodeci
  • "Bring My Mail" – Contains a sample of "Ring My Bell" by Anita Ward
